摘要
We demonstrate effective, up to 30%, reflection of the surface plasmon-polariton wave (SPP) from a nanogroove made on Ag film surface. The use of SPP reflection from a nanogroove having a shape of parabola helps to realize a new element in nanoplasmonics—parabolic SPP mirror. It was found that the mirror allows focusing of the SPP into a diffraction-limited spot with a lateral size of about λSPP (λSPP = 800 nm—SPP wavelength). The possibility of spatial scanning the focusing spot of SPP on the surface of Ag film is shown.
